Understanding Nicotine and Its Function
Nicotine is a plant-based organic substance found in tobacco plants but is by no means the single cause of the health problems that come with smoking. The principal risk posed by conventional tobacco products is the toxic chemicals that are released by burning tobacco. Nicotine, if consumed in moderate amounts and in a less harmful form, does not pose such negative consequences on the body as smoking. This is a crucial fact that separates fact from fiction in the consumption of nicotine.

The Myths About Nicotine
Nicotine is no worse than tobacco smoking. One of the largest myths is that nicotine itself is no worse than tobacco smoking. The truth is that nicotine is an addictive drug but not the one that directly causes the smoking health risks. Tobacco smoking generates harmful by-products like tar and carbon monoxide that are responsible for the majority of the diseases caused by smoking. Nicotine alone can cause side effects but not the same chronic diseases as smoking.
Nicotine causes cancer. Nicotine does not cause cancer. Even though tobacco smoking has been found to be carcinogenic, nicotine alone has not been found to have the same level of carcinogenicity. The capacity to cause cancer in smoking has largely been attributable to the substances released on burning tobacco rather than the nicotine. Nicotine is a quit-smoking product. One of the best advantages of nicotine is that it helps individuals quit smoking. Nicotine replacement therapy (NRT) has been proven to suppress the behavior of individuals smoking cigarettes in the long term. NRT products such as nicotine gum, patches, and lozenges have found widespread use as quit-smoking products. Smokers who resort to healthier means of acquiring nicotine can reduce their likelihood of developing the severe health issues brought about by smoking.
